## Break-Glass: CronShift Migration

So we're mid-migration from crontab soup to the Loomwork workflow engine, and sometimes a half-migrated job wedges both systems. If that happens and nobody senior is around, use break-glass: pause the Loomwork namespace, re-enable the legacy cron entry, and note it in the migration log. The pause command will ask for the recovery passphrase, given right below.

strongbox words: norwyn-wenael-aldvan-aldiel-wendor-holael

Dear all,

As you know, our lease on the Kestrel Plaza offices expires in March. Following three rounds of discussion with the landlord, Brindlewood Estates, we have secured a provisional 12% reduction in base rent in exchange for a five-year commitment and assumption of certain maintenance costs. Marta has reviewed the draft terms and flags no material concerns, though the escalation clause still needs tightening. Please treat the figures as preliminary. The strategic rationale behind our position is summarised below.

board note of bawep-tajef: Queniusek Systems plans to raise the Quenvan list price by 53.1 percent in March. The pricing group signed off on a budget of $176.4 million for Project Drueth. The renewal with Casionix Partners closes at $142.5 million a year, 8.3 percent below the last contract. Project Fraax slips by six weeks because of the tooling delay.

## Runbook: Gildroot Donation-Receipt Mailer

If receipts stop going out, check the `gildroot-mailer` pod logs first — usually it's the nightly batch choking on a malformed donor record. Skip the bad row with `gr-mail requeue --skip-invalid` and move on. Restarts are safe; sends are idempotent. After any redeploy, confirm the env file still contains the mailer's auth line:

env line for fafof-fahag: LEDGER_TOKEN5=f8790

## Deploying the scanner bridge

Welcome aboard! The Beeptrack service sits between our warehouse barcode scanners and the Cartwheel inventory API. Deploys are boring on purpose: push to main, CI builds the image, and the Harlow cluster rolls it out in about two minutes. Scanners reconnect automatically, so don't panic if the dashboard flickers mid-deploy. Before your first deploy, make sure your local env mirrors production. These are the settings the bridge runs with.

service settings:
WENOX_PIN=1918
WENOX_METRICS_HOST=metrics.wenox.lumicworks.corp
WENOX_LOG_LEVEL=info
WENOX_TENANT=belion